One of the most sought-after skills today is AWS. Amazon Web Services has gained a lot of popularity within the last few years and it’s easy to learn! In this blog post, we will talk about some ways you can learn AWS without spending too much time or money.
Table of Contents
What is AWS and what does it do?
AWS is a cloud-computing platform that provides on-demand computing resources like storage and servers to help developers build, deploy, and scale their applications. AWS also offers tools for big data analytics across an array of industries such as finance, retail, government intelligence agencies, and more.
There are over 175 different types of services offered through AWS which continues to grow daily with new additions. This list includes Elastic Compute Cloud (EC2), Lambda Functions, Amazon Machine Learning service (Amazon ML) among many others. These products provide developers access to the scalable infrastructure needed when working on large projects or developing machine learning algorithms without needing in-depth knowledge about operating systems or managing server clusters themselves.
Why should you learn it?
AWS is the leading cloud computing service provider, providing a broad range of products to help you build modern applications. Whether you are a developer or system administrator or manager, you will learn something new on AWS.
Learning AWS can help you to grow into your career and learn skills that can be applied to a variety of jobs.
The top 7 reasons to learn AWS is listed below
The leading cloud platform
More than 170+ services and growing daily.
The largest community of customers and partners
Fastest pace of innovation
Most proven operational expertise (14+ years )
A global network of AWS Regions( 24 regions, 77 AZ )
How to get started with AWS?
Luckily, to learn AWS you don’t need a college degree or even have programming experience. There are many different ways that individuals can learn about the cloud and its possibilities without spending money on tuition fees.
There are many ways to learn AWS and here we will discuss a few among them.
YouTube is the largest video-sharing platform where many creators share their tutorial videos, which can be viewed freely. There are many YouTube creators who have created tutorials on AWS, such as “Intellipaat”, “Simplilearn”, and many more.
You can easily learn AWS by watching those tutorial videos and practicing them regularly. AWS offers some services for free for the first 12 months after signup. So you can practice those examples without any cost.
You can learn AWS by reading different blogs. Blogs are also a great resource to learn AWS. There are many blogs on the internet with different authors that provide free content on their blog posts about learning AWS and how to use it effectively.
One such example is “The Practical Dev”. It’s one of the most well-known blogs out there for developers and coders who want to learn some technical skills from scratch, as they have tutorials, courses, tips, tricks, etc.
You can learn AWS by listening to different podcasts as well. The podcasts can be audio or video, and they are available on different sources such as YouTube and iTunes.
One example of a podcast is “AWS This Week”. It’s made for people who learn better by listening to someone speak.
The host of the show will give an overview about AWS features in that week’s episode, then discuss how you could use those services with some examples which listeners are more likely able to learn from it than just reading articles online trying to figure out what this all means – while also being entertained at the same time! The best part? They’re free!
A classic way to learn AWS by reading books. There’s a lot of books out there that are good, and we actually have another blog post about the best AWS Books to learn from.
The most popular book so far is “AWS Lambda in Action”. It explains core services such as Amazon ECs or SQS with detailed examples and code snippets.
Another great book for beginners is “A Cloud Guru Guide to Building your First Serverless Application”. What makes it unique? The author walks you through step-by-step how to build an application without worrying about servers!
Online courses are a great way to learn AWS. These courses give a demonstration on hands of training you learn from.
One of the most popular online course providers is Udemy, and they have a good selection to choose from. There are other providers as well like edX, Coursera.
Online courses are a great way to learn AWS. These courses give you hands-on training without the need for having any prior experience!
So take the course that you think is appropriate for you and start learning.
Best practices for learning AWS
Best practices for learning AWS may not be a course, but instead, they are tips to learn the basics of AWS.
The best way to learn is by doing it hands-on and experimenting with your own account first before trying in production!
It’s almost impossible to know everything about AWS because there is so much information out there, you can always learn more as time goes on.
At first, try to learn from YouTube videos and practice with your free tier account. Then read those blogs and listen to podcasts. They are also a great source of knowledge.
Start with the basics and learn AWS. For example, how do you create a new server?
How to learn about autoscaling groups or as an example of something really advanced, try learning about Lambda functions!
Learning AWS can be difficult but it is possible. Use these tips for best practices on what to learn when starting out.
How long does it take to learn AWS?
This depends on your current knowledge and willingness to learn.
For beginners, it will take about half a year to learn AWS with limited knowledge of cloud computing. If you know of what is happening under the hood and have experience in software development or system administration, then this could take as little as two weeks!
Be patient if you are not an expert at writing code for servers like Linux or networking – these skills can be learned from other sources more quickly than those that require heavy programming background (and they’re always useful).
Which AWS course is best for beginners?
This is really a question of “what do you want to learn?” and not so much about the AWS course itself. As with any IoT, there are many ways to learn but only one way that is right for a specific person at a given time.
Tips for getting the most out of your time spent learning about AWS
- Be patient if you are not an expert at writing code for servers like Linux or networking – these skills can be learned from other sources more quickly than those that require heavy programming background (and they’re always useful).
- Learn the basics of AWS before diving into something complicated, such as ECU or IoT. This will allow you to learn about foundational tenets and concepts before moving onto advanced topics which builds a solid knowledge base.
Learn how to use Amazon Web Services in your favorite IDE or Code Editor with our Learning Labs tutorials! These labs cover the fundamentals of The New AWS Management Console, Creating & Testing API Requests, Using Lambda Functions, Developing Serverless Applications With Step Functions.
Is AWS Certification enough to get a job?
Is AWS Certification enough to get a job?
No. AWS Certification is not enough to get a job unless you have experience in the field or are looking for an entry-level position.
In order to learn how to learn was try, out our Learning Labs tutorials! These labs cover the basics of The New AWS Management Console, Creating & Testing API Requests, Using Lambda Functions, and Developing Serverless Applications With Step Functions.
Is AWS training free?
There are some free resources available on the AWS Training site.
However, there are only a few hands-on labs to learn and play with some features.
If you want more depth or a better understanding of topics, we recommend our training classes where you can learn about all aspects of Amazon Web Services in an interactive classroom setting.
Is coding required for AWS?
Coding is not required to learn AWS. However, there are some developers who will find it easier and more productive if they learn how to code in languages like Python or Java.
For those that do not want to learn to code, you can still access the same resources using a web browser on any computer.
If you would like help learning how to use AWS without writing your own code we recommend our training classes which cover all aspects of Amazon Web Services in an interactive classroom setting where students don’t need prior coding knowledge.
In this post, we’ve covered a few different ways to learn AWS. We hope that you found one or two of these helpful – it’s up to you! If not, then try some other methods and see what works best for your situation. Remember that there is no “right” way to do things; the most important thing is finding something sustainable so that you can keep learning new skills over time. Good luck in your quest! Do any of these work well for you? Have they helped with anything specific yet? Leave us a comment below!